SPR Auto Technologies Limited has accepted the resignation of Mr. Pankaj Gupta from the position of Company Secretary and Compliance Officer. The resignation, effective from the close of business hours on June 15, 2026, was tendered due to personal reasons via a letter dated March 27, 2026.
The company disclosed this development in a filing submitted to the National Stock Exchange of India Limited and BSE Limited. The intimation was made pursuant to Regulation 30 of the SEBI (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2015.
Mr. Gupta was relieved of his duties and responsibilities on June 15, 2026. The resignation also covered his role as Head – Legal and other designated positions held within the organization.
